Vocabulary

Major karma points...

Kat: So you're going on a tour with Jude.
Jamie: I don't know. She hasn't decided.
Kat: Okay, I'm only gonna say this once I better be
getting major karma points. Hope she is not to say it in vain?

Gotta stop letting her lead, Jamie.
  

Top answer

This is youth vernacular meaning "I had better be gaining significant favor" in exchange for what I am putting up with. As you know, the Hindu and Bhuddist concept of karma contends an individual's punishment or reward in the next life is, in part, the ethical consquence of his or her behavior in this one.
